To open a closed sharps container safely, it’s important to do so without risking injury. Here’s how you can approach it:

Check for a removable lid: Some sharps containers have a hinged lid or a screw-on top that can be opened. Look for a tab or area to unscrew or detach the lid.

Push or twist (if applicable): If the container has a locking mechanism, like a twist cap, gently twist it counterclockwise to release it. Some containers have a press-and-release feature, where you press a tab and then lift the lid.

Avoid force: If the lid is stuck, don’t force it. Instead, check for instructions on the container or contact the supplier or manufacturer for guidance.

Wear gloves: If you’re handling the container for disposal or sorting, it’s a good practice to wear gloves for protection.

If you need to dispose of it: If the container is full and you’re trying to close it to prevent spillage, many sharps containers have a special feature to permanently seal them when they are full. Make sure to check if the container has any mechanism that ensures it’s safely closed after being filled.

If dealing with a specific type of sharps container which have unique features, generally, tools such as screwdriver and plier is needed, and the sharps box cannot be restored to normal use after opening. After opening, observe the inside of the sharps box. There is no other purpose. The sharps box needs to be closed again and properly discarded.
